I have a solaris 7 NIS master.
I established a solaris 8 slave.
Do I need to update the Master that it is now has a slave? how?

If you try to configure a server as a NIS slave, you should make it to NIS client first. Add all the name information of this machine to the NIS master. Use "ypmake" command on the master to rebuild the NIS database. Then issue "ypinit -s mastername" to make it to a salve.
